Title: The Innovative Contributions of Takehito Bogauchi
Introduction: Takehito Bogauchi, an esteemed inventor based in Takatsuki, Japan, has made significant contributions to the field of battery technology. With a total of four patents to his name, Bogauchi's work has advanced the efficiency and performance of energy storage solutions, marking him as a notable figure in the innovation landscape.
Latest Patents: Among his latest inventions are two critical patents:
1. The "Hydrogen Absorbing Electrode and its Manufacturing Method" describes an innovative hydrogen absorbing electrode that utilizes a hydrogen absorbing alloy composed of transition metals from groups VIIb, VIII, or Ib of the periodic table. This invention features a surface rich layer of transition metals that eliminates the need for activation during the initial charge/discharge phase, thereby enhancing the effectiveness of nickel-hydride secondary batteries.
2. The "Separator for Alkali-Zinc Battery" consists of a microporous membrane engineered with alkali resistance. This separator incorporates a hydrophilic section that effectively controls ZnO precipitation, thus preventing dendrite short-circuiting in batteries. Meanwhile, the water-repellent portion of the membrane allows for adequate O₂ gas permeability, ensuring sustained battery capacity.
